//
// Platform reference PLD Form Factor definiton
//
Scope(\_SB) {
//
// Cabinet 0 Primary Front
//
Name (C0PF, Package (0x1) {
ToPLD (
PLD_Revision = 0x2,
PLD_IgnoreColor = 0x1,
PLD_Red = 0x0,
PLD_Green = 0x0,
PLD_Blue = 0x0,
PLD_Width = 0x320, //800 mm
PLD_Height = 0x7D0, //2000 mm
PLD_UserVisible = 0x1, //Set if the device connection point can be seen by the user without disassembly.
PLD_Dock = 0x0, // Set if the device connection point resides in a docking station or port replicator.
PLD_Lid = 0x0, // Set if this device connection point resides on the lid of laptop system.
PLD_Panel = "TOP", // Describes which panel surface of the systems housing the device connection point resides on.
PLD_VerticalPosition = "CENTER", // Vertical Position on the panel where the device connection point resides.
PLD_HorizontalPosition = "RIGHT", // Horizontal Position on the panel where the device connection point resides.
PLD_Shape = "VERTICALRECTANGLE",
PLD_GroupOrientation = 0x0, // if Set, indicates vertical grouping, otherwise horizontal is assumed.
PLD_GroupToken = 0x0, // Unique numerical value identifying a group.
PLD_GroupPosition = 0x0, // Identifies this device connection points position in the group (i.e. 1st, 2nd)
PLD_Bay = 0x0, // Set if describing a device in a bay or if device connection point is a bay.
PLD_Ejectable = 0x0, // Set if the device is ejectable. Indicates ejectability in the absence of _EJx objects
PLD_EjectRequired = 0x0, // OSPM Ejection required: Set if OSPM needs to be involved with ejection process. User-operated physical hardware ejection is not possible.
PLD_CabinetNumber = 0x0, // For single cabinet system, this field is always 0.
PLD_CardCageNumber = 0x0, // For single card cage system, this field is always 0.
PLD_Reference = 0x0, // if Set, this _PLD defines a reference shape that is used to help orient the user with respect to the other shapes when rendering _PLDs.
PLD_Rotation = 0x0, // 0 - 0deg, 1 - 45deg, 2 - 90deg, 3 - 135deg, 4 - 180deg, 5 - 225deg, 6 - 270deg, 7 - 315deg
PLD_Order = 0x3, // Identifies the drawing order of the connection point described by a _PLD
PLD_VerticalOffset = 0x0,
PLD_HorizontalOffset = 0x0
)
} // Package
) //C0PF
